Legal Frameworks Supporting Geographical Indications and Biodiversity Preservation
Legal frameworks are fundamental in supporting and regulating the relationship between geographical indications and biodiversity preservation. They establish the legal recognition of specific products linked to distinctive geographical regions, thus promoting sustainable use of local biodiversity.
Key legislation includes international treaties such as the TRIPS Agreement under the World Trade Organization (WTO), which sets minimum standards for geographical indication protection. Many countries implement national laws that delineate rights and responsibilities of producers and other stakeholders.
Legal protections often involve the registration process, which safeguards authentic products against misuse or misrepresentation. Additionally, laws may include provisions for biodiversity conservation, ensuring that the use of geographical indications does not lead to overexploitation.
For effective implementation, legal frameworks may encompass:
- Certification and quality standards
- Enforcement mechanisms to prevent fraudulent claims
- Policies encouraging sustainable harvesting and local community participation

Challenges in Aligning Geographical Indications with Biodiversity Goals
Aligning Geographical Indications with biodiversity goals presents several challenges that can hinder effective conservation efforts. One significant issue is the risk of over-commercialization, which may prioritize economic gains over ecological sustainability, undermining conservation objectives.
Misuse and misrepresentation also pose threats; stakeholders might exploit Geographical Indications for branding, leading to false claims that do not reflect actual biodiversity richness. This can damage the integrity of such designations and reduce real conservation impact.
Furthermore, conflicts can arise between economic development and biodiversity preservation. Local communities may prioritize short-term benefits from Geographical Indications, potentially harming local ecosystems or neglecting conservation needs.
Addressing these challenges requires careful regulation and collaboration among stakeholders. Ensuring transparency and adherence to ecological standards is crucial for maintaining the balance between Geographical Indications and biodiversity conservation efforts.
